WebArcsin. Arcsin is one of the six main inverse trigonometric functions. It is the inverse trigonometric function of the sine function. Arcsin is also called inverse sine and is mathematically written as arcsin x or sin-1 x (read as sine inverse x). If f (x) = f (− x), then F (x) is even. Even functions are symmetrical about the y-axis. If f (− x) = − f (x), then F (x) is odd. Odd functions are symmetry about the origin.
